![]() A boil water notice in Appalachia is still in effect after a landslide, but one lane has been reopened. The Appalachia Fire Department posted on Facebook that the landslide occurred on Exeter Road which caused the water main break. One lane of the road is back open now, and the water line has been repaired, but the boil water notice will remain in effect until late Thursday. Crews were called to the landslide at around 7:30 a.m. on Tuesday and worked all day to clear the road. VDOT worked alongside the Appalachia Public Works to repair the water line on Tuesday. Public Works personnel will continue cleanup efforts along the road today and VDOT will begin work on the road in the near future. The landslide affected 107 households.
